- The distance between Raufarhöfn, Iceland and Port Harcourt, Nigeria is approximately 7,076 km or 4,397 mi.
- To reach Raufarhöfn in this distance one would set out from Port Harcourt bearing 350°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Raufarhöfn bearing 334.3° or NNW .
- Raufarhöfn has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Port Harcourt has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- Raufarhöfn is in or near the subpolar rain tundra biome whereas Port Harcourt is in or near the tropical mo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 24.7 °C (44.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.7 °C (13.9°F) more in Raufarhöfn.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1561.7 mm (61.5 in) less which is equivalent to 1561.7 l/m² (38.33 US gal/ft²) or 15,617,000 l/ha (1,669,561 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 50.8° lower in Raufarhöfn than in Port Harcourt.
